Fashion Brands Take Control of Resale Market

The Resale Revolution: Fashion's Biggest Brands Take Control The global secondhand apparel market is projected to reach $393 billion by 2030, growing twice as fast as the broader apparel market.

This surge in demand is not surprising, given consumers' increasing interest in sustainable and affordable fashion options. As a result, some of fashion's biggest brands are launching their own resale platforms.

For years, eBay, Depop, Poshmark, and The RealReal have generated billions in sales of these brands' products without them ever touching a penny.
